WWE’s developmental cuts are still rolling, and Anya Rune is now the latest name out.
Sean Ross Sapp revealed on September 4, 2026 that Rune is part of WWE’s latest round of cuts, adding another young talent to a list that has continued growing throughout the night.
Rune, whose real name is Airica Demia, entered WWE’s system after taking part in the company’s February 2026 tryouts in Orlando. WWE later connected her with the Anya Rune name before she started getting television time through WWE Evolve.
She quickly became part of the Evolve women’s division, competing in a Fatal 4-Way for a spot in the vacant Evolve Women’s Championship match and later wrestling names including Layla Diggs, Zena Sterling and Skylar Raye. Now that run is over before Rune ever got the chance to move into a regular NXT role.
